Here’s a breakdown of the key takeaways from the provided text:
* Ukraine’s Military Strategy Shift: The text describes a shift in thinking regarding Ukraine’s defense against Russia. The author argues against further large-scale mobilization of soldiers, deeming the conditions for them “almost incompatible with survival.”
* Focus on Technology: The core of the proposed strategy is to invest heavily in technology, specifically systems that protect soldiers’ lives and neutralize Russia’s advantage in manpower (willingness to accept high casualties).
* “Robotic Army” is Unrealistic: A complete replacement of soldiers with robots is considered unattainable.
* Five-Point Plan: A comprehensive, state-controlled technological conversion is proposed, focusing on advanced defense systems, notably autonomous and robotic technologies.
* State Control & Resources: The plan requires a dedicated state strategy (like the one for nuclear energy), and ensuring enough IT specialists and trained soldiers.
In essence, the article advocates for ukraine to prioritize technological solutions over simply throwing more soldiers into the conflict, recognizing Russia’s willingness to sustain heavy losses.
